Description
Fiverr Clone Script 1.2.2 contains an SQL injection vulnerability that allows unauthenticated attackers to manipulate database queries by injecting SQL code through the page parameter. Attackers can supply malicious SQL syntax in the page parameter to extract sensitive database information or modify database contents.
